What we know about ATE brake discs
The brand is registered in Germany.
In March 2026, PartReview users have a positive opinion of ATE brake discs.
PR Score — 89 out of 100, based on 53 reviews and 168 votes. 44 positive reviews, 9 neutral reviews, 0 negative reviews. Average rating — 4.2 (out of 5). Vote balance: 150 up, 18 down.
In the ranking of the best brake discs this part is at position 7, behind R1 Concepts and Brembo , but ahead of Raybestos and DBA.
Users also evaluated the qualities of ATE brake discs:
- Braking - car slows predictably without fade when you press the pedal - rated positively. 4.2 points out of 5.
- Vibration - pedal pulsation or steering wheel shake during braking - rated negatively. 2 points out of 5.
- Noise - squeal or squeak while braking - rated ambivalently. 3.3 points out of 5.
